    Does the ticket mention the Road Traffic Act? I suspect not. Did this heinous crime (not diplaying a permit?? Off to the Tower with them!!) take place on public Highway or a private car park (by the sounds of it?). As maninthestreet says, if it was on behalf of a council it would be for £50 or £60 or so.

    So to answer your question - No, they do not have the powers of enforcement. No Parking sounds to me like trespass. In which case ONLY the landowner (not a parking company they have employed) or a representative solicitor could bring an action of trespass against anyone.

    That's before we get to the point, that not diplaying a pass doesn't make your friend a trespasser anyway.

    By all means let us know if the ticket DOES mention the Road Traffic Act, but in the meantime, ignore the ticket, and ignore all the scary letters that they will send threatening all sorts of legal scary stuff, which in actual fact is meaningless rubbish.

    Before anything is ignored ensure they are not acting for a council, you can tell by who the payment is to and who the appeal is also to. But at £200 it doesn't look like a local authority pcn
    Excel Parking, MET Parking, Combined Parking Solutions, VP Parking Solutions, ANPR PC Ltd, & Roxburghe Debt Collectors. What do they all have in common?
    They are all or have been suspended from accessing the DVLA database for gross misconduct!
